Top definition
The awesomest Black-sounding-name-for-a-dood at OMGPOP. You can find her lurking at MNFH. She's a Mod so she is very moody (especially when she gets blue balls). But she's nice. Still nice..
vanillakid23: all these time i've been imagining toodi as a black dood

toodi: LOL
toodi: wait wut?
by vanillakid23 September 07, 2011
Get the mug
Get a toodi mug for your cousin Vivek.